Taylor Kolinski’s Heroics Lead Archers to 1-0 Victory Over Jefferson College
In a thrilling matchup on October 19, 2024, the St. Louis Community College Archers secured a hard-fought 1-0 victory over Jefferson College, thanks to a stellar performance by goalkeeper Taylor Kolinski. The win, which took place at Jefferson College's home field, was decided by a goal in the opening minute of the game.
The Archers got off to a lightning-fast start, with Jenna Duchinsky scoring in the first minute off an assist from Kamiah Hoffman. That early strike proved to be the game-winner, as St. Louis Community's defense, anchored by Kolinski, held firm throughout the match.
Kolinski was the standout player of the day, making six crucial saves, including a dramatic penalty kick save in the final minutes that preserved the shutout and sealed the win for the Archers. Her composure under pressure and quick reflexes were key in denying Jefferson College's scoring opportunities, especially from Codi Potter, who had three shots on goal.
Jefferson College goalkeeper Brooklyn Moll made three saves but was unable to stop the early goal that gave St. Louis Community the lead. Both teams had an even number of chances, but the Archers capitalized when it mattered most, while Kolinski's strong play ensured Jefferson College couldn't break through.
With this win, St. Louis Community College has secured the #1 seed in the Region 16 Tournament and earned a first-round bye. The Archers' dominant performance throughout the season has positioned them as the top team in the region.
The Archers will host the winner of Game 1 on Wednesday, October 30th at 2:00 PM on the STLCC Florissant Valley Soccer Field. As the #1 seed, St. Louis Community College will look to continue their strong run as they advance into the semifinals of the tournament.
